What is endoscopic ear surgery? Endoscopic ear surgery (EES) is a minimally invasive surgical technique used to treat conditions of the ear, particularly those affecting the middle ear. EES allows surgeons to visualize the ear structures in great detail on a monitor, providing a wide and well-lit view of the surgical field.
